Latest Patents

Lavigne's latest patents include innovative cemented carbide compositions. One of his notable inventions involves a cemented carbide composition that features a hard phase made of tungsten carbide (WC) as a first hard phase component, along with a second hard phase component selected from tantalum carbide (TaC), niobium carbide (NbC), and mixtures thereof. This composition also includes a binder phase made from cobalt (Co), nickel (Ni), and mixtures thereof. Another patent focuses on a cemented carbide designed for high-demand applications, which is resistant to corrosion and erosion, making it suitable for oil and gas flow applications. This particular grade includes constituents such as Co, Ni, Cr, Mo, and WC, with specific weight percentages for optimal performance.
